Toy Story 5 Teaser Sets Woody and Buzz Against a Digital Device

Exactly 30 years since the first Toy Story film was released, establishing Pixar as a leading film company and bringing viewers to iconic figures like the cowboy doll (the actor) and Buzz Lightyear (Tim Allen), who are now household names.

Coming in 2026, the fifth installment is scheduled for release. The initial preview for Toy Story 5 appeared this week, offering a glimpse into the storyline but keeping fans wondering how it will resolve the ending of Toy Story 4.

Bonnie's New Toy: A Digital Device Frightens the Gang

The preview reveals the young girl — who inherited the toy collection when he grew up — getting a brand new plaything, one that alarms the familiar toy group. Bonnie gets her first tablet computer, and she is thrilled about it.

Theoretically, the amphibian-inspired device will animate just like the rest of her playthings. However, the toys seem to view it as a threat coming to replace them, which it likely will.

Woody's Return: Unanswered Questions from Toy Story 4

An element the teaser avoids is why the sheriff is returned with his friends in the child's bedroom. The end of Toy Story 4 saw him set off on a fresh journey with Bo Peep (Annie Potts), traveling with a carnival and assisting giveaway items locate loving owners.

Certainly, the filmmakers will explain the consequences of Toy Story 4 in the movie. Witnessing him show up in the familiar setting without warning is a little strange, however. It also raises questions whether his partner will have returned with Woody. And what about the stuntman toy (Keanu Reeves)?

Connections from the Last Installment

At the very least, some elements are carrying over from the prior film. The final act the cowboy did before departing for his fresh path was pass his symbol of authority to Jessie (the voice actor), entrusting her in charge of the toy domain. The clip shows the insignia attached to her outfit.

It is hoped she is still the key figure among the toys.
